Riverside Golf Club is appropriately named. The course sits in a floodplain along the Trinity River with water in play on seemingly every hole. This is a combination links-style/traditional layout that is surprisingly difficult for a municipal course. Great holes abound on the Roger Packard layout, which requires the rare combination of length and accuracy when playing from the tips.

Holes 4-6 offer one of the better stretches of golf, starting with a 462-yard par 4 that is cut in the landing area by pesky fairway bunkers, and features a long approach into an elevated green that is surrounded by water and slopes back-to-front. Club down on no. 4 because leaving it short still offers the chance for an up-and-down. No. 5 is a good par 3, especially from the middle tees where it generally plays as a short iron. Watch for the front pin placement, which can leave you with a long downhill putt if the tee shot is too long. Water looms to the right but it takes a bad shank to dunk it in the drink. No. 6 goes 543 yards, doglegging left along the Trinity with water fronting the green. The tee shot must be long and straight, and anything too far right leaves a precarious second shot around the bend.

The back side is the more fun of the two, taking you through good combinations of holes that offer excellent birdie opportunities if you’re on your game. You'll need those birds when you come down the home stretch.

I used to play Riverside quite a bit years ago and returned with out-of-town guest. It was in very good shape for all the rain we've had this year. Greens were in excellent shape. It was always one of my favorite courses on this side of DFW. The pace of play was horrible, though. VERY slow group of four in front of us which was adamantly opposed to letting my twosome play through, and there were no course marshals to be found. The GPS system was off on pin placements on virtually every hole, too. Playing to what you think is a front pin on a green that's 60 feet deep when the pin is actually back is not a good thing.

Tough But Fair

Tough but short layout from the white tees. Very tough from the tips. Avoid the bunkers unless you like fried eggs. Bring an extra sleeve (lots of water and the Trinity River is on your left for few holes). Shot placement is key to a good round. Have fun!
